Screen and treat men ≥35 years and women ≥45 years of age for lipid disorders by obtaining, at the minimum, total cholesterol and high-density lipoprotein levels. These can be checked in a nonfasting state. Screen and treat men 20-35 years and women 20-45 years of age if they have increased risk for coronary heart disease ...

WebMar 23, 2024 · A cardiovascular risk assessment is an assessment of a person's risk of cardiovascular disease (CVD), such as the risk of developing heart disease or a stroke, and provides an assessment of the degree of risk. The assessment provides an estimate of your risk of developing CVD over the following 10 years.
